文章 2017-08-16 来自:开发者社区

C语言字符串的另类用法

讲这个例子前,咱们先来看一个简单的程序: 字符串数组实现数字转字母: #include <stdio.h> #include <string.h> int main(void) { int num = 15 ; //26个字母 const char str[] = "abcdefghijklmnopqlstuvwxyz" ; //这个做法是将num这个十进制数...

文章 2017-08-01 来自:开发者社区

《C语言程序设计:问题与求解方法》——2.12节数据输入—格式化输入库函数scanf()的用法

本节书摘来自华章社区《C语言程序设计:问题与求解方法》一书中的第2章,第2.12节数据输入—格式化输入库函数scanf()的用法,作者:何 勤,更多章节内容可以访问云栖社区“华章社区”公众号查看 2.12 数据输入—格式化输入库函数scanf()的用法在程序运行过程中,我们想要在某语句处暂时中断程序的运行,通过键盘输入数据到变量所对应的内存单元中,就要在程序中事先写好输入库函数调用语句。scan....

文章 2017-08-01 来自:开发者社区

《C语言程序设计:问题与求解方法》——2.11节数据输出—格式化输出函数 printf()的用法

本节书摘来自华章社区《C语言程序设计:问题与求解方法》一书中的第2章,第2.11节数据输出—格式化输出函数 printf()的用法,作者:何 勤,更多章节内容可以访问云栖社区“华章社区”公众号查看 2.11 数据输出—格式化输出函数 printf()的用法 变量的值如果不从内存单元中取出来,通过输出设备送到计算机的外部,这个值对外界就不起任何作用,程序本身的运行也就失去了意义。1.变量值的输出格....

文章 2017-07-04 来自:开发者社区

C++中对C语言结构体用法的扩充

最近在学习C++,了解到,C++中对C做了扩充,使用结构体时也可以像类一样,规定私有数据类型和公有数据类型,同时也可以在struct中实现方法设置等等。 但为了保持面对对象的特性,建议还是使用class来描述一个类。 案例如下: #include <iostream> #include <ctime> using namespace std ; typedef stru.....

问答 2016-06-14 来自:开发者社区

C语言比较难懂的关于数字0的用法?

看代码的时候, 看到一段这样的:( (size_t)& ((void *)0)->member ) 请问这个0是什么意思, 用在这里, 代表什么??? 这条语句有什么作用.

文章 2016-05-18 来自:开发者社区

C语言外部变量的使用以及erxtern的用法

网上有很多帖子问C语言中extern的用法,而且回答的详细程度各尽不同. 所以我就像写一篇博文来谈谈我对extern的看法,不一定十分恰当,只当大家共勉. 变量定义性声明和引用性声明 变量的声明有两种情况: 1、一种是需要建立存储空间的。 例如:int a 在声明的时候就已经建立了存储空间。 2、另一种是不需要建立存储空间的。 例如:extern int a 其中变量a是在别的文件...

文章 2016-05-11 来自:开发者社区

C语言宏高级用法 [总结]

1、前言     今天看代码时候,遇到一些宏,之前没有见过,感觉挺新鲜。如是上网google一下,顺便总结一下,方便以后学习和运用。C语言程序中广泛的使用宏定义,采用关键字define进行定义,宏只是一种简单的字符串替换,根据是否带参数分为无参和带参。宏的简单应用很容易掌握,今天主要总结一下宏的特殊符号及惯用法。   (1)宏中包含特殊符号:#、##.     &nb...

C语言宏高级用法 [总结]
文章 2016-04-20 来自:开发者社区

C语言函数指针的用法

函数指针是一种在C、C++、D语言、其他类 C 语言和Fortran 2003中的指针。函数指针可以像一般函数一样,用于调用函数、传递参数。在如 C 这样的语言中,通过提供一个简单的选取、执行函数的方法,函数指针可以简化代码。 函数指针只能指向具有特定特征的函数。因而所有被同一指针运用的函数必须具有相同的参数和返回类型。 本文地址:http://www.cnblogs.com/archi...

问答 2016-03-05 来自:开发者社区

C语言关于#用法的错误

#include #define NAME ABC #define AGE 21 void main() { fprintf( "我是" #NAME ",年龄"#AGE"\n"); getchar(); } 我是想用# 来实现 输出 我是ABC,年龄21 这样的结果.这么做的初衷是尝试各种方式运用define功能,是自己理解

文章 2014-12-12 来自:开发者社区

C语言语法笔记 – 高级用法 指针数组 指针的指针 二维数组指针 结构体指针 链表 | IT宅.com

原文:C语言语法笔记 – 高级用法 指针数组 指针的指针 二维数组指针 结构体指针 链表 | IT宅.com C语言语法笔记 – 高级用法 指针数组 指针的指针 二维数组指针 结构体指针 链表 | IT宅.com C语言语法笔记 – 高级用法 指针数组 指针的指针 二维数组指针 结构体指针 链表本文由 arthinking 发表于315 天前 ⁄ itzhai.com原创文章 ...

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。

开发与运维

集结各类场景实战经验,助你开发运维畅行无忧

+关注